Mode of action, effects on strength and endurance
Benzac AC Gel works primarily by releasing oxygen into the skin, which effectively kills the anaerobic bacteria responsible for acne. It also assists in preventing pores from clogging, reducing the risk of breakouts and thereby allowing athletes to focus on their performance without the distraction of skin problems.

Precautions, medical advice
While Benzac AC Gel 2.5% Galderma is generally safe for most users, it is essential to follow certain precautions and seek medical advice when necessary. Athletes should perform a patch test prior to extensive application to rule out any allergic reactions. Avoid applying the gel on sensitive areas of the skin, such as around the eyes or mouth, as this may lead to irritation.
Additionally, it is vital to consult a healthcare professional if severe skin reactions occur or if symptoms persist despite usage. Pregnant or breastfeeding women should also seek advice before using any topical treatments. | Active substance | Benzoyl Peroxide |
|---|---|
| Water Retention | None |
| Hepatotoxicity | None |
| Lab Test | Not routinely tested in standard labs |
| Strength | 2.5% |
| Also known as | BPO, dibenzoyl peroxide |
| Blood pressure | No effect |
| Trade name | Benzac, PanOxyl, Persa-Gel |
| Storage conditions | Store at room temperature away from heat and direct sunlight |
| Chemical name | Benzoyl Peroxide |
| Formula | C14H10O4 |
| Substance class | Organic peroxide |
| Main action | Antimicrobial and keratolytic |
| Half-life | Short, rapidly decomposes upon application |
| Dosage (medical) | Typically 2.5% to 10% creams or gels applied once or twice daily |
| Dosage (sports) | Not applicable |
| Effects | Reduces acne by killing bacteria and peeling away skin layers |
| Side effects | Dryness, redness, burning, peeling, and possible swelling |
